| Executive retreats and team building events are a mainstay
in mid- and large-size companies, as well as many smaller
businesses, and provide a supportive environment that is
dedicated to establishing new goals, revising policies and
procedures that are no longer effective, determining how
best to guide and grow the company, and choosing the best
tack for moving forward into a strong, successful future. In
addition, they are a great way to bolster teamwork and
cohesiveness within an organization. Whether or not your
company is in need of a significant change in course, an
executive retreat at sea is sure to provide the setting and
motivation needed to deliver the results your firm needs. Executive retreat cruises can be easily arranged for small or large groups and can allow for up to a 40% savings over planning your event at a land-based venue. Additionally, all-inclusive cruises are ideal for establishing and staying within your company's budget with meals, accommodations, entertainment, drinks, onboard activities and meeting facilities included in one upfront price. At the same time, cruise ships offer many additional luxuries that your participants can choose to partake in, such as spa treatments, boutique shopping and land excursions, which increases the appeal this option will have to your attendees. Executive retreats at sea have the dual benefits of providing well-equipped meeting facilities that will assist participants in staying motivated and meeting goals, while also allowing your participants to enjoy a memorable, relaxing vacation experience when not in meetings. This allows your executives to accomplish the necessary tasks and return to the office at the end of the retreat refreshed, revitalized and ready to implement the policies or changes agreed upon during the retreat.
